Aims | To support parents to develop good oral health habits for their young child/children through effective behaviour change conversations | ||
Objectives | Be able to recognise barriers and facilitators to communication when having conversations in the surgery Be able to recognise barriers and facilitators to communication when having conversations remotely (telephone, video call). Understand how different models of communication can impact a behaviour change conversation. Be able to apply essential communication skills to a behaviour change conversation | ||
Learning outcomes | At the end of this course delegates will be able to: Use reciprocal communication techniques during behaviour change conversations Consider physical and environmental barriers to communication when planning behaviour change conversations Utilise specific effective communication skills to support behaviour change conversations | ||
